Abstract

Several patches are available on the market to perform carotid endarterectomy (CE) with angioplasty, including prosthetic and biological patches; among these, pericardial patches are relatively recent. In spite of the growing use of biological patches, few data are available in the literature comparing the results of these two types of patches. The aim of this study was to compare the short and long term results of bovine pericardium (BP) and prosthetic patches (PP) used for carotid endarterectomy.
